ORDERS FOR TUESDAY, NOVEMBER 28, 2023
Ms. SMITH. Mr. President, I ask unanimous consent that when the
Senate completes its business today, it stand adjourned until 10 a.m.
on Tuesday, November 28; that following the prayer and pledge, the
Journal of proceedings be approved to date, the morning hour be deemed
expired, the time for the two leaders be reserved for their use later
in the day, and morning
[[Page S5618]]
business be closed; that upon the conclusion of morning business, the
Senate proceed to executive session to resume consideration of the
Bryan nomination, postcloture; further, that all time be considered
expired at 11:30 a.m. and the Senate recess following the cloture vote
on the Garnett nomination until 2:15 p.m. to allow for the weekly
caucus meetings; further, that if cloture has been invoked on the
Garnett nomination, all time be considered expired at 2:15 p.m.; and,
finally, that if any nominations are confirmed during Tuesday's
sessions, the motions to reconsider be considered made and laid upon
the table and the President be immediately notified of the Senate's
action.
The PRESIDING OFFICER. Is there objection?
Hearing none, it is so ordered.
